As APIs disponibilizadas no Swagger utilizam o Basic Authentication, que é o sistema de autenticação mais comum no protocolo HTTP. Na tela de parâmetros da Lib DN, que é pré-requisito para todas as customizações, existe um processo que permite gerar o Token de forma simples.
Para isso, basta acessar o TOTVS Educacional | Customização | Parâmetros Gerais, conforme imagem abaixo:
Image Added
Na tela que se abrirá, existe um processo "Gerar Token". Nele, será solicitado o usuário e senha para login no TOTVS Educacional, que será utilizado para a autenticação nas APIs disponibilizadas. Ao finalizar a execução do processo, o Token será gerado no campo "Basic Auth", no formato Basic xxxxxxxx, conforme imagens abaixo:
Image Added
Image Added
Image Added
O token deverá ser enviado em todas as requisições no cabecalho HTTP "Authorization". Nos tópicos abaixo serão apresentados exemplos de utilização via POSTMAN e via código em diferentes linguagens.
|